Pre Labor Day Week Ryde

Well the wife and I just returned from a Pre-labor Day week long ryde and it was fabulous. Our 2013 RTL performed marvelously. What a blast. We left Sacramento and headed down I5 to 156. Headed for Hollister and Highway 25. What a road, great surface, no traffic, and beautiful scenery even in the depths of our drought. When I say no traffic, I mean NO TRAFFIC. On this 60 to 70 mile run down to 198 we saw 4 other vehicles, and they were in fact, other motorcycles that we rode with for a while. From 198 we headed down 101 to Atascadero for a couple of nights with friends. On Thursday we headed down 101 to Arroyo Grande for ice cream at Doc Burnsteins Ice Cream Lab ( formerly Bernardoz) for the most awesome ice cream ever. When you are on the central coast stop in, you will not be sorry. The weather was perfect high 60s with bright sunshine and you could see forever.

Friday morning saw us leaving Atascadero down to Morro Bay and up Highway 1. This was beyond belief. Highway 1 is 100 miles from Morro Bay to Monterey all alnong the Coast of California. The views are breath taking with shear cliffs dropping to the sea on one side, and majestic mountains on the other side. This was early on the first day of a long weekend and there was no traffic heading north. Again perfect weather. We stopped to view a few hundred Elephant Seals basking on the beach and headed north past Hearst castle toward Big Sur. stopped at the Nepenthe Inn for what AAA calls one of the best burgers in Northern California and that did not disappoint. Then we headed to our next destination. We were forced to spend two nights in Monterey:yes::yes::yes:, what torture. Out to dinner with family for some just caught seafood to die for,and a great visit with Mom and Sister. Saturday we headed north to Santa Cruz for lunch on the warf at our Favorite Stagnaro Brothers, more fresh seafood!

What made this trip on a long weekend so blissful was, we left on Wednesday, and returned on Sunday and therefore no TRAFFIC! Alas as all good things must come to an end, and on Sunday it was back home to Sacramento. But get this I5 was deserted. Any of you that know that highway know how crowded that strip of asphalt gets, and we could see no one for miles. Back home to rest an recollect. What a great time. 891 trouble free miles and smiles as Bob likes to say. If you are in California try some of these roads, if you have you are probably smiling with me now.
